O R D E R

Challenging the order passed in I.A.No.200 of 2014 in O.S.No.84 of 2014 on the file of the Subordinate Judge, Dharmapuri, the defendants have filed the above Civil Revision Petition.

2. I.A.No.200 of 2014 has been filed by the respondent/plaintiff for temporary injunction under Order 39 Rules 1 and 2 CPC. The trial Court allowed the application, against which the present civil revision petition has been filed by the defendants.

3. Since the impugned order passed in I.A.No.200 of 2014 is an appealable order under Order 43 Rule 1(r) CPC, the civil revision petition filed by the defendants under Article 227 of the Constitution of India is not maintainable.

In view of the same, the civil revision petition is rejected. It is open to the petitioners/defendants to challenge the impugned order passed in I.A.No.200 of 2014 by way of an appeal. No costs. Consequently, connected miscellaneous petition is closed.
